Boyne Thunder 2023 Pace Lap
 
We have a few months to go, but looking for some boater input. Each year we have a tuff time with group 4 in the Pace Lap.This will be our 20th year, I have been helping for 19 years of it. The Cats have a hard time staying trimmed out at our low starting speed. Last year was a mess. My thoughts are to take the v-bottem's and break them up into 4 groups to put a good show on for the crowd with the parade lap, Then let the Cats leave straight down the lake from Sommerset and not go thru the Parade Lap. Once again, this is not aimed at anyone or is this ment to be a negative post. Just trying to get some input to take to the board. Last year we had some Cats get some speeding tickets on Lake Charlevoix. I want to keep this a safe and fun time. We have to deal with the 55 mph speed limit on Lake Charlevoix so we do not jeopardize our Coast Guard permit for Lake Charlevoix. If you have some thoughts, please feel free to post them up.

Blue Oval 12-07-2022 06:28 AM

If anyone looking In questions what went on with group 4 last year:
1-everyone in the group passed the pace boat doing the legal speed. 2-three of the cats got tickets for for running over 100 mph on Lake Charlevoix. 3-several of the boats did not follow the pace boat thru the parade lap, they chose to treat my Marshall Boats like orange cones and weave in and out of them. I think that is a pretty good overview. I spent 45 minutes with water patrol immediately following the pace lap. It was not a real friendly conversation.
